Responsibilities
• Flight Nurses will assess each situation to determine the best course of action to support, monitor and treat patients in critical care situations.
• Utilize critical thinking skills to manage the critically ill or injured adult or pediatric patient and support physicians’ orders.
• Take pride in providing a safe, clean, and well-stocked aircraft environment, maintains regular equipment and base checks, and complies with safety standards and briefings.
• Work collaboratively and effectively communicate in a professional manner with air and ground teams, dispatch, flight crews, facilities and partners.
• Share shift change info to transitioning team and follow protocols to maintain accurate company and regulatory documentation and records.
• Nurses are accountable to maintain required certifications and ongoing training required for the position.

Minimum Qualifications
• Three years of experience in an Emergency or Adult Critical Care setting as a licensed RN.
• Current RN license in the states served by the assigned area.
• EMT Certification in state(s) where required.
• BLS, ACLS, PALS, NRP required prior to flight status (NRP certification is provided during New Hire Training).
• Trauma Certification where required

Preferred Qualifications
• Prior flight experience.
• Instructor certifications in BLS, ACLS, PALS/PEPP, ITLS/PHTLS.

Other Qualifications
• Advanced Certification (CEN, CCRN, CFRN) required within 24 months from date of hire.
